查看: 75  |  回复: 0
VB6 VB真的死了吗?
楼主
发表于 3月21日 22:36

1、无异于挑起争论,而是争论就摆在前面,已经到了荒谬的程度。笔者并非培训卖课之流,仅仅碰巧研究过VB的小小安全工作者。以笔者的经验,VB系在Windows上,尤其适合非IT职业人士进行编程拓荒之旅。但谣言甚众,不得不以正视听。
2、#VBA# 作为Office二开体系中的一员,无论是使用的便捷性,还是功能的扩展性,都深受众多职场人士的喜爱。但市井之间忽然刮起了替代之风,VBA一度被传得摇摇欲坠。如果深入了解Office的扩展体系,就会明白加载项+VBA,对于经典Office而言,已经是全场景覆盖了。至于Office365,也有前端成熟的技术体系。因此,替代的价值更无从谈起。
3、VBA有第7版本托底,VB6就没这么幸运了。作为上古BASIC的继任者,注定要遭受竞争者们的口诛笔伐,甚至带上莫须有的罪名。这对于广大非专业IT来讲,是不公平的。VB6到底Low不Low无所谓,但要赶尽杀绝,斩草除根,又何必呢?让更多的人,拿起效率的武器,多贡献个人力量,共同应对老美的无耻,难道不好么?
4、然而VB6这打不死的小强,已然说明了江湖的险恶。为五斗米折腰的,何止个案!到目前为止,微软官方只是停更了VB6的IDE。看看,都掀被子了!
5、VB一开始,就是Windows的形象代言人。她要做的,就是充分展示Windows的特性。这是为什么,VB在Windows上能够呼风唤雨的原因之一。是的,她看上去是有点特权。甚至很多人说,老盖特意让C/C++弄了一套晦涩的东西,只为迎合VB使用。这是对重用特征的一大玷污。
大家对面向对象口若悬河,对继承、多态信手拈来,却视VB为异类!COM不仅仅是解决分布式计算的产物,它更是不同级别领域的重用机制。面向对象在源码层面重用,但COM却是在二进制层面重用。诺大的系统工程,要是没有二进制层面的重用,那得是多大的噩梦!
6、VB6没有64位的IDE,也不会影响她在64位Windows上的工作能力!这是Windows自身特点和X86硬件共同决定的。从这个层面,VB6只要有自己的编译器,她将在Windows上活过大多数污蔑她的人!

您需要登录后才可以回帖 登录 | 立即注册
【本版规则】请勿发表违反国家法律的内容,否则会被冻结账号和删贴。
用户名: 立即注册
密码:
2020-2024 MaNongKu.com